Hire Velocity
4 days ago Be among the first 25 applicants
This position will be working closely with a team of senior engineers designing and releasing both the software and hardware for items such as single board computers, environmental control and measurement, and LED sign message control. The successful candidate will be involved in all aspects of product and system design to firmware and control software development to product release and post-release support.
#1 Importance: Write complete code utilizing a project concept analysis, design review, development, peer review, test and release process.
Become the designated owner of specific code bases.
Design software features to meet product requirements
Write technical specifications and assist with functional specifications
Troubleshoot and debug existing products and perform new development
Research networking protocols and practices, development techniques, and quality improvement methods, and share your knowledge with the team
Validating products against standards documents
Working with and supporting production and customer service
Creating test documentation/procedures and test/validation programs
AREAS OF EXPOSURE :
Embedded to higher level programming (C++)
Embedded firmware
Circuit and system design
Real-time embedded systems
Microcontroller and SOC architectures
Serial communication protocols RS2332, RS485, Ethernet, SPI, I2C, CP/IP, UDP, HDLC, snmp, SPI
Design for testability
QUALIFICATIONS
5+ years experience as an Embedded Software Engineer
Software development experience in Linux & hardware environments (We are developing with Linux / C++)
C and C++ in an Embedded environment
Embedded systems, microprocessors (ARM,PIC,STM), memory (SRAM, DDR), I/O
Design software features to meet product requirements
CPLD and FPGA processing understanding/exposure
Troubleshooting skills using lab equipment such as logic analyzer
Write technical specifications and assist with functional specifications as well as the creation of test documentation, procedures and validation.
Validate products against standards documents
Translate incomplete/ambiguous/verbal requirements into detailed technical specifications
Ability to work on several projects simultaneously
Flexible attitude fostering the ability to work closely with others
Some travel may be required (5%)
Seniority level
Seniority level
Mid-Senior level Employment type
Employment type
Full-time Job function
Job function
Engineering and Design Industries
Wholesale Appliances, Electrical, and Electronics and Appliances, Electrical, and Electronics Manufacturing Referrals increase your chances of interviewing at Hire Velocity by 2x Inferred from the description for this job
Medical insurance Vision insurance Get notified when a new job is posted. Sign in to set job alerts for Embedded Software Engineer roles.
Embedded Software/Firmware Engineer - GTRI - Open Rank
Senior Embedded Firmware Engineer Storage Controllers
Were un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I. #J-18808-Ljbffr
Seniority level
Mid-Senior level Employment type
Employment type
Full-time Job function
Job function
Engineering and Design Industries
Wholesale Appliances, Electrical, and Electronics and Appliances, Electrical, and Electronics Manufacturing Referrals increase your chances of interviewing at Hire Velocity by 2x Inferred from the description for this job
Medical insurance Vision insurance Get notified when a new job is posted. Sign in to set job alerts for Embedded Software Engineer roles.
Embedded Software/Firmware Engineer - GTRI - Open Rank
Senior Embedded Firmware Engineer Storage Controllers
Were un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I. #J-18808-Ljbffr